If the price of cantaloupe increases, the marginal utility per dollar of cantaloupe:


A) decreases, so the consumer buys fewer cantaloupes, and the demand curve for cantaloupes slopes downward.
B) increases, so the consumer buys more cantaloupes, and the demand curve for cantaloupes slopes downward.
C) increases, so the consumer buys fewer cantaloupes, and the demand curve for cantaloupes slopes downward.
D) decreases, so the consumer buys fewer cantaloupes, and the demand curve for cantaloupes slopes upward.
